Day 1: On arrival in Lincoln the coach will set down at the ‘top’ of the town in an area known as Bailgate. This is the most historic area and you’ll find lots of independent, quirky shops and cosy tea rooms in the cobbled streets and the most famous Street in the City – ‘Steep Hill’ which leads down to the lower part of the town.
Do visit the Cathedral while you are here. The exterior is impressive – it was the tallest building in the world for over 200 years during the medieval period. Inside it’s as magnificent as it is ancient.
At the opposite end of Bailgate you’ll see the Castle. Again, well worth a visit if you have time. Within the impenetrable stone walls lies one of only four remaining original copies of the Magna Carta. Your chance to see an important piece of English history.

We leave Lincoln around 12:30pm and start to make our way home. About an hour into our journey, we stop in Sherwood Forest. We set down at the Visitor centre near Edwinstowe village. You can get refreshments here and something to eat if you wish and within a 10 minute walk you will find the world-famous Major Oak, still producing acorns after standing at the heart of the forest for an estimated 800 years!
